<p>Under the point system, a person's license can either be suspended if they accumulate 8 points (16 points for drivers who operate motor vehicles for employment purposes) or be revoked if they accumulate 12 points. </p>
<p>The following points are assessed for speeding and other speed related traffic law violations: Reckless driving-12 points; </p>
<p>speeding in excess of the posted speed limit by 21 MPH or more-5 points; </p>
<p>speeding in excess of the posted speed by 16 to 20 MPH-4 points; </p>
<p>speeding in excess of the posted speed limit by 11 to 15 MPH-3 points; </p>
<p>for all other accident violations-3 points; and, for all other non-accident violations-3 points. CDCR 18-3-303.2(b), (c) &amp; (d), 18-3-303.3, 18-3-303.4 and 18-3-303.5</p>
